af957eebfc KVM: nVMX: don't use vcpu->arch.efer when checking host state on nested state load
When loading nested state, don't use check vcpu->arch.efer to get the
L1 host's 64-bit vs. 32-bit state and don't check it for consistency
with respect to VM_EXIT_HOST_ADDR_SPACE_SIZE, as register state in vCPU
may be stale when KVM_SET_NESTED_STATE is called---and architecturally
does not exist.  When restoring L2 state in KVM, the CPU is placed in
non-root where nested VMX code has no snapshot of L1 host state: VMX
(conditionally) loads host state fields loaded on VM-exit, but they need
not correspond to the state before entry.  A simple case occurs in KVM
itself, where the host RIP field points to vmx_vmexit rather than the
instruction following vmlaunch/vmresume.

However, for the particular case of L1 being in 32- or 64-bit mode
on entry, the exit controls can be treated instead as the source of
truth regarding the state of L1 on entry, and can be used to check
that vmcs12.VM_EXIT_HOST_ADDR_SPACE_SIZE matches vmcs12.HOST_EFER if
vmcs12.VM_EXIT_LOAD_IA32_EFER is set.  The consistency check on CPU
EFER vs. vmcs12.VM_EXIT_HOST_ADDR_SPACE_SIZE, instead, happens only
on VM-Enter.  That's because, again, there's conceptually no "current"
L1 EFER to check on KVM_SET_NESTED_STATE.

964b7aa0b0 KVM: Fix steal time asm constraints
In 64-bit mode, x86 instruction encoding allows us to use the low 8 bits
of any GPR as an 8-bit operand. In 32-bit mode, however, we can only use
the [abcd] registers. For which, GCC has the "q" constraint instead of
the less restrictive "r".

Also fix st->preempted, which is an input/output operand rather than an
input.

48b71a9e66 NFC: add NCI_UNREG flag to eliminate the race
There are two sites that calls queue_work() after the
destroy_workqueue() and lead to possible UAF.

The first site is nci_send_cmd(), which can happen after the
nci_close_device as below

nfcmrvl_nci_unregister_dev   |  nfc_genl_dev_up
  nci_close_device           |
    flush_workqueue          |
    del_timer_sync           |
  nci_unregister_device      |    nfc_get_device
    destroy_workqueue        |    nfc_dev_up
    nfc_unregister_device    |      nci_dev_up
      device_del             |        nci_open_device
                             |          __nci_request
                             |            nci_send_cmd
                             |              queue_work !!!

Another site is nci_cmd_timer, awaked by the nci_cmd_work from the
nci_send_cmd.

  ...                        |  ...
  nci_unregister_device      |  queue_work
    destroy_workqueue        |
    nfc_unregister_device    |  ...
      device_del             |  nci_cmd_work
                             |  mod_timer
                             |  ...
                             |  nci_cmd_timer
                             |    queue_work !!!

For the above two UAF, the root cause is that the nfc_dev_up can race
between the nci_unregister_device routine. Therefore, this patch
introduce NCI_UNREG flag to easily eliminate the possible race. In
addition, the mutex_lock in nci_close_device can act as a barrier.

d2a69fefd7 i40e: Fix changing previously set num_queue_pairs for PFs
Currently, the i40e_vsi_setup_queue_map is basing the count of queues in
TCs on a VSI's alloc_queue_pairs member which is not changed throughout
any user's action (for example via ethtool's set_channels callback).

This implies that vsi->tc_config.tc_info[n].qcount value that is given
to the kernel via netdev_set_tc_queue() that notifies about the count of
queues per particular traffic class is constant even if user has changed
the total count of queues.

This in turn caused the kernel warning after setting the queue count to
the lower value than the initial one:

$ ethtool -l ens801f0
Channel parameters for ens801f0:
Pre-set maximums:
RX:             0
TX:             0
Other:          1
Combined:       64
Current hardware settings:
RX:             0
TX:             0
Other:          1
Combined:       64

$ ethtool -L ens801f0 combined 40

[dmesg]
Number of in use tx queues changed invalidating tc mappings. Priority
traffic classification disabled!

Reason was that vsi->alloc_queue_pairs stayed at 64 value which was used
to set the qcount on TC0 (by default only TC0 exists so all of the
existing queues are assigned to TC0). we update the offset/qcount via
netdev_set_tc_queue() back to the old value but then the
netif_set_real_num_tx_queues() is using the vsi->num_queue_pairs as a
value which got set to 40.

Fix it by using vsi->req_queue_pairs as a queue count that will be
distributed across TCs. Do it only for non-zero values, which implies
that user actually requested the new count of queues.

For VSIs other than main, stay with the vsi->alloc_queue_pairs as we
only allow manipulating the queue count on main VSI.

cf9acc90c8 net: virtio_net_hdr_to_skb: count transport header in UFO
virtio_net_hdr_to_skb does not set the skb's gso_size and gso_type
correctly for UFO packets received via virtio-net that are a little over
the GSO size. This can lead to problems elsewhere in the networking
stack, e.g. ovs_vport_send dropping over-sized packets if gso_size is
not set.

This is due to the comparison

  if (skb->len - p_off > gso_size)

not properly accounting for the transport layer header.

p_off includes the size of the transport layer header (thlen), so
skb->len - p_off is the size of the TCP/UDP payload.

gso_size is read from the virtio-net header. For UFO, fragmentation
happens at the IP level so does not need to include the UDP header.

Hence the calculation could be comparing a TCP/UDP payload length with
an IP payload length, causing legitimate virtio-net packets to have
lack gso_type/gso_size information.

Example: a UDP packet with payload size 1473 has IP payload size 1481.
If the guest used UFO, it is not fragmented and the virtio-net header's
flags indicate that it is a GSO frame (VIRTIO_NET_HDR_GSO_UDP), with
gso_size = 1480 for an MTU of 1500.  skb->len will be 1515 and p_off
will be 42, so skb->len - p_off = 1473.  Hence the comparison fails, and
shinfo->gso_size and gso_type are not set as they should be.

Instead, add the UDP header length before comparing to gso_size when
using UFO. In this way, it is the size of the IP payload that is
compared to gso_size.

fs: handle circular mappings correctly
When calling setattr_prepare() to determine the validity of the attributes the
ia_{g,u}id fields contain the value that will be written to inode->i_{g,u}id.
When the {g,u}id attribute of the file isn't altered and the caller's fs{g,u}id
matches the current {g,u}id attribute the attribute change is allowed.

The value in ia_{g,u}id does already account for idmapped mounts and will have
taken the relevant idmapping into account. So in order to verify that the
{g,u}id attribute isn't changed we simple need to compare the ia_{g,u}id value
against the inode's i_{g,u}id value.

This only has any meaning for idmapped mounts as idmapping helpers are
idempotent without them. And for idmapped mounts this really only has a meaning
when circular idmappings are used, i.e. mappings where e.g. id 1000 is mapped
to id 1001 and id 1001 is mapped to id 1000. Such ciruclar mappings can e.g. be
useful when sharing the same home directory between multiple users at the same
time.

As an example consider a directory with two files: /source/file1 owned by
{g,u}id 1000 and /source/file2 owned by {g,u}id 1001. Assume we create an
idmapped mount at /target with an idmapping that maps files owned by {g,u}id
1000 to being owned by {g,u}id 1001 and files owned by {g,u}id 1001 to being
owned by {g,u}id 1000. In effect, the idmapped mount at /target switches the
ownership of /source/file1 and source/file2, i.e. /target/file1 will be owned
by {g,u}id 1001 and /target/file2 will be owned by {g,u}id 1000.

This means that a user with fs{g,u}id 1000 must be allowed to setattr
/target/file2 from {g,u}id 1000 to {g,u}id 1000. Similar, a user with fs{g,u}id
1001 must be allowed to setattr /target/file1 from {g,u}id 1001 to {g,u}id
1001. Conversely, a user with fs{g,u}id 1000 must fail to setattr /target/file1
from {g,u}id 1001 to {g,u}id 1000. And a user with fs{g,u}id 1001 must fail to
setattr /target/file2 from {g,u}id 1000 to {g,u}id 1000. Both cases must fail
with EPERM for non-capable callers.

Before this patch we could end up denying legitimate attribute changes and
allowing invalid attribute changes when circular mappings are used. To even get
into this situation the caller must've been privileged both to create that
mapping and to create that idmapped mount.

This hasn't been seen in the wild anywhere but came up when expanding the
testsuite during work on a series of hardening patches. All idmapped fstests
pass without any regressions and we add new tests to verify the behavior of
circular mappings.

3751c3d34c net: stmmac: Fix signed/unsigned wreckage
The recent addition of timestamp correction to compensate the CDC error
introduced a subtle signed/unsigned bug in stmmac_get_tx_hwtstamp() while
it managed for some obscure reason to avoid that in stmmac_get_rx_hwtstamp().

The issue is:

    s64 adjust = 0;
    u64 ns;

    adjust += -(2 * (NSEC_PER_SEC / priv->plat->clk_ptp_rate));
    ns += adjust;

works by chance on 64bit, but falls apart on 32bit because the compiler
knows that adjust fits into 32bit and then treats the addition as a u64 +
u32 resulting in an off by ~2 seconds failure.

The RX variant uses an u64 for adjust and does the adjustment via

    ns -= adjust;

because consistency is obviously overrated.

Get rid of the pointless zero initialized adjust variable and do:

	ns -= (2 * NSEC_PER_SEC) / priv->plat->clk_ptp_rate;

which is obviously correct and spares the adjust obfuscation. Aside of that
it yields a more accurate result because the multiplication takes place
before the integer divide truncation and not afterwards.

Stick the calculation into an inline so it can't be accidentally
disimproved. Return an u32 from that inline as the result is guaranteed
to fit which lets the compiler optimize the substraction.

806401c20a net/mlx5e: CT, Fix multiple allocations and memleak of mod acts
CT clear action offload adds additional mod hdr actions to the
flow's original mod actions in order to clear the registers which
hold ct_state.
When such flow also includes encap action, a neigh update event
can cause the driver to unoffload the flow and then reoffload it.

Each time this happens, the ct clear handling adds that same set
of mod hdr actions to reset ct_state until the max of mod hdr
actions is reached.

Also the driver never releases the allocated mod hdr actions and
causing a memleak.

Fix above two issues by moving CT clear mod acts allocation
into the parsing actions phase and only use it when offloading the rule.
The release of mod acts will be done in the normal flow_put().

2eb0cb31bc net/mlx5: E-Switch, rebuild lag only when needed
A user can enable VFs without changing E-Switch mode, this can happen
when a user moves straight to switchdev mode and only once in switchdev
VFs are enabled via the sysfs interface.

The cited commit assumed this isn't possible and exposed a single
API function where the E-switch calls into the lag code, breaks the lag
and prevents any other lag operations to take place until the
E-switch update has ended.

Breaking the hardware lag when it isn't needed can make it such that
hardware lag can't be enabled again.

In the sysfs call path check if the current E-Switch mode is NONE,
in the context of the function it can only mean the E-Switch is moving
out of NONE mode and the hardware lag should be disabled and enabled
once the mode change has ended. If the mode isn't NONE it means
VFs are about to be enabled and such operation doesn't require
toggling the hardware lag.
